Swimming Flippers and Diving Fins Essential for Enhanced Underwater Performance

Optimizing your underwater movements is crucial for both recreational swimmers and professional divers. High-quality swimming flippers and diving fins offer increased propulsion efficiency, reducing fatigue and enabling smoother glide through water. These fins are engineered with ergonomic designs that maximize thrust, allowing users to conserve energy while covering greater distances. Key features such as adjustable straps, durable materials, and hydrodynamic blades contribute to superior control and enhanced performance under varying aquatic conditions.

Benefits of Using Swimming Flippers and Diving Fins:

  • Improved speed and maneuverability
  • Increased leg strength and endurance
  • Enhanced safety by enabling quick responses
  • Compatibility with other diving gear for seamless experience
Flipper TypeBest ForMaterialPrice Range
Full Foot FinsWarm Water SnorkelingSilicone$$
Open Heel FinsScuba DivingRubber, Plastic$$$
Split FinsEnergy-Saving SwimmingComposite$$$

Choosing the Right Snorkeling Goggles for Clear and Comfortable Exploration

Selecting the ideal pair of snorkeling goggles involves balancing comfort, visibility, and durability to ensure an enjoyable underwater experience. Key features to consider include lens type, frame design, and strap adjustability. Tempered glass lenses offer superior clarity and resistance to scratches, while polycarbonate lenses provide a lightweight, budget-friendly option. The gasket material is crucial for comfort and a watertight seal-silicone gaskets are widely preferred for their flexibility and durability compared to rubber alternatives. Additionally, an adjustable strap with a quick-release mechanism enhances ease of use and ensures a snug fit without causing pressure around the eyes.

For practical comparison, consider the following aspects when evaluating snorkeling goggles:

  • Field of View: Wide-angle or panoramic lenses expand peripheral vision underwater, crucial for tracking marine life.
  • Anti-Fog Coating: Prevents lens fogging, maintaining clear visibility throughout your dive.
  • Low Volume Design: Reduces the amount of air space inside the goggles, making equalizing easier and improving comfort during extended use.
FeatureBenefitBest For
Tempered Glass LensHigh clarity, scratch-resistantFrequent and professional use
Silicone GasketComfortable seal, durableLonger snorkel sessions
Adjustable StrapCustom fit, easy to adjustAll face shapes
Wide Field of ViewEnhanced peripheral visionExplorers and nature watchers

Comprehensive Guide to Scuba Diving and Swimming Fins Sets for Adult Divers

When selecting the ideal fins for adult scuba divers, several critical factors come into play. Comfort and fit top the list, as poorly fitted fins can cause blisters or cramps during extended underwater excursions. Look for adjustable straps or full-foot designs based on personal preference and diving conditions. Additionally, the material construction-typically rubber or silicone-impacts both durability and flexibility. Lightweight fins reduce fatigue and enhance maneuverability, while sturdier models provide better propulsion in strong currents. For snorkeling and recreational swimming, shorter blade fins offer ease of movement, whereas longer blades are preferred for technical diving where powerful thrust is necessary.

To help divers make informed choices, here is a quick comparison of popular fin types and their features:

Fin TypeBlade LengthBest UseMaterial
Full-footShort to MediumWarm water snorkeling, casual swimmingRubber
Open-heelMedium to LongScuba diving with boots, technical divingSilicone/Rubber
Split finsMediumReduced effort for long dives, energy-savingComposite materials
Paddle finsLongStrong propulsion in currents, professional useRubber/Silicone blend

Pairing your fins with quality snorkeling goggles and dive snorkels further enhances your underwater experience. Look for sets that offer ergonomic design, anti-fog lenses, and snorkels with splash guards for optimal performance. Investing in a reliable fins set tailored to your diving style and environment is essential for safety, efficiency, and comfort beneath the waves.
